A walks 30m towards east direction and turns to the north and walk 40m. How far is he from his original position

Explanation:
the Pythagoras theorem will be applying in this take 30 m as the base 40 m as perpendicular so ans will be
√30*30+40*40
√900+1600
√2500
√5*5*5*5*2*2
5*5*2
=50 m ans
